Friendly fire incident in the Red Sea: US jet fighter hit by USS Gettysburg cruiser

The incident is not related to enemy fire. Investigation underway, minor injuries to one of the pilots recovered

A US F/A-18 fighter jet flying over the Red Sea was hit in what appears to be a case of friendly fire, according to the US Central Command (Centcom). The incident involved the missile cruiser USS Gettysburg, which mistakenly hit the aircraft during a patrol mission related to security operations in the region in response to Houthi attacks.

The pilots and their condition

Both pilots of the fighter jet were promptly recovered, with one of them suffering only minor injuries. Centcom clarified that the incident was not caused by an enemy attack and that an investigation is underway to determine the exact causes of what happened.

An operational error

According to initial assessments, the cruiser USS Gettysburg mistakenly fired at and hit the F/A-18, which had taken off from the aircraft carrier USS Harry S. Truman, one of the main US naval assets currently deployed on the international patrol mission in the Red Sea.
